Cookies

On our Website, we use Cookies to enhance your experience and gather information about visitors and visits to or use of the Website. A Cookie is a small piece of computer code sent by a website and stored on the hard disk of your computer. Our website uses session cookies. Session cookies exist only for as long as your browser remains open. We use session cookies, for example, to manage items added to your shopping bag. Your web browser can be set to notify you when a cookie is received so that you may choose whether the accept it.  For more information about cookies, and how to disable cookies, visit https://www.allaboutcookies.org.

Safeguarding Information

We implement a variety of security measures to maintain the safety of your PII when you place an order or enter, submit, or access your PII.

Our Website has various procedural, technical, and administrative measures to safeguard the information we collect and use. We offer the use of a secure server. All supplied sensitive information is transmitted via Secure Socket Layer (SSL) technology and then encrypted into our payment gateway provider’s database only to be accessible by those authorized with special access rights to such systems and required to keep the information confidential. SSL is an encryption standard that provides a layer of security while information is being transmitted over the Internet.

As a matter of procedure, we do not disclose details regarding our security measures as this could be beneficial information to cyber criminals.

Be advised, no security safeguards or standards are guaranteed to provide 100% security. You should always use appropriate self-protection measures and practice safe browsing on all websites.
